Summary
Rashee Rice, the former three star recruit, is one of the most productive players in SMU history. Over the course of three years he amassed 3,000+ yards and 25 scores. Rice wins with aggressive hands and physical plays at the catch point. He is an explosive leaper with exceptional body control. Rice was one of the top players in all of college football during 2022 when it came to contested catches. His physical nature carries over to his blocking as well, where his hard nosed style translates both out wide and in the slot. The concern with Rice is how translatable his game is at the next level. There are not a lot of players that win in contested catch scenarios at around 6’ 0” in the league. Rice is not a fast player (4.51 40 Time) and he doesn’t really separate versus man coverage. He does have a well rounded route tree and a good nose for the soft spots in zone, so his long term home may be optimal as a slot. Lack of elite physical traits for an outside receiver at his size and a play style that may not translate well leaves him closer to an Early Day 3-Late Day 2 player. Rice should be a stalwart special teams player at the worst. In the right system he can be a solid WR3 due to his blocking and dependable hands. He should be able to carve himself out a nice role in the NFL as a QB’s safety blanket that does the little things well. Rice projects as a strong number three receiver that adds a layer of physicality and reliable ball skills to an offense.
Grade: 5.87 - 4th Round Grade (Has a Chance to Contribute)
